Relief for relatives as Lockerbie verdict draws near

The families of those who died in the Lockerbie disaster are today finally hearing whether the two Libyans accused of mass murder are innocent or guilty.

A handful of families were in court yesterday to hear Lord Sutherland announce when the judges will hand down their verdict.
